Transaction 31310456d3352471e2509b24d90c15e1dcc5b77caaf72f047c5a32ea55021dc9
1 Input
2 Outputs
- 31310456d3352471e2509b24d90c15e1dcc5b77caaf72f047c5a32ea55021dc9:0
- 31310456d3352471e2509b24d90c15e1dcc5b77caaf72f047c5a32ea55021dc9:1
value 639880
address 3JAqr2nRqzMobffsF1s8jPHxG9rmqrBYmg
value 22660206
address 1NasfPnf2SnYFJw2KskZe6jSFtZFPDhev